A new strike has been reported near Iran’s Bushehr Nuclear Power Plant, according to information shared with the International Atomic Energy Agency (IAEA).
Iranian authorities informed the agency that a projectile landed in the vicinity of the facility. However, officials stated that the nuclear plant itself was not damaged and no injuries were reported among staff.
Earlier, Iran’s Atomic Energy Organization confirmed the incident, emphasizing that operations at the plant remain stable and unaffected.
In response, IAEA Director General Rafael Grossi reiterated calls for restraint, warning that any escalation near nuclear facilities could pose serious safety risks. He stressed the importance of avoiding actions that could endanger critical infrastructure during ongoing tensions in the region.
The Bushehr facility is one of Iran’s key nuclear energy sites, making any nearby military activity a significant concern for international observers.
The situation continues to be closely monitored as tensions persist across the Middle East.
